Harry Kane risks ruining his legacy at Tottenham if he joins Manchester United, according to Dimitar Berbatov.

The England skipper is considering his future in north London and is yet to hold talks over a new deal at the club.

Kane’s current contract expires in 2024 and this summer could be Spurs’ final opportunity to receive a suitably high fee for the forward.

The forward wanted to leave the club in 2021 to join Manchester City but Daniel Levy blocked his move to the north-west.

Kane has since gone on to become Spurs’ record scorer and Erling Haaland’s move to Etihad has blocked any hopes of joining Pep Guardiola’s side.

Manchester United now lead the race for Kane but Berbatov, who made the move from north London to Old Trafford himself, believes Kane will stay put as it could ruin his legacy at the club.

‘First of all, is it going to be another saga of Harry Kane being linked with a move somewhere and nothing happens?’ Berbatov told Betfred.

‘This is something that’s happened in the last couple of transfer windows. Based on that, I don’t believe that a move will happen.

‘I think Harry Kane’s legacy at Tottenham is so big, especially with him becoming the greatest goalscorer in the club’s history, that a move to another team in the Premier League could tarnish that legacy he’s built and would make the fans angry as well.

‘A move a few years ago would have been a bit more acceptable in terms of his legacy at Spurs but now I don’t believe a move is going to materialise now. Harry becoming Tottenham’s all-time leading goalscorer is a great achievement and he fully deserves it.’
